Heidmar Maritime Holdings Corp. (HMR) is a maritime shipping company operating in the energy transportation sector. The stock has drawn attention from traders as it navigates current market conditions near the $0.86 price level. HMR shares experienced a modest decline in recent trading, with the security moving lower by approximately 0.47% during the latest session.
